What Is Generic Keflex?

Definition and Overview

Generic Keflex refers to the non-branded version of the medication cephalexin. It belongs to the class of antibiotics known as cephalosporins, which are structurally and functionally similar to penicillins. The primary purpose of this medication is to combat bacterial infections by inhibiting the growth and spread of bacteria.

Brand vs. Generic

  • Keflex: The brand-name version manufactured by Eli Lilly and Company.
  • Generic Keflex: Equivalent version produced by various pharmaceutical manufacturers. It contains the same active ingredient, dosage, and effectiveness as the brand but is typically more affordable.

How Does Cephalexin Work?

Mechanism of Action

Cephalexin works by disrupting the synthesis of bacterial cell walls, leading to bacterial cell death. It targets specific enzymes involved in building the bacterial cell wall, which human cells do not possess, making it selective for bacteria.

Effectiveness Against Bacteria

This antibiotic is effective against a broad spectrum of bacteria, including:

  1. Staphylococcus (including some strains resistant to penicillin)
  2. Streptococcus species
  3. Haemophilus influenzae
  4. Escherichia coli
  5. Proteus mirabilis
  6. Neisseria gonorrhoeae

Common Uses of Generic Keflex

Infections Treated

Generic Keflex is prescribed for various bacterial infections, including but not limited to:

  • Respiratory tract infections (sinusitis, pharyngitis, tonsillitis)
  • Skin and soft tissue infections (abscesses, cellulitis, impetigo)
  • Urinary tract infections (UTIs)
  • Bone infections
  • Ear infections (otitis media)
  • Gonorrhea

Prescription Guidelines

The dosage and duration depend on the type and severity of the infection. Typically, healthcare providers prescribe cephalexin tablets or capsules taken orally, with doses ranging from 250 mg to 1000 mg per day divided into several doses.

Potential Side Effects and Risks

Common Side Effects

Most people tolerate cephalexin well, but some may experience mild side effects, including:

  • Gastrointestinal issues: nausea, vomiting, diarrhea
  • Rash or allergic skin reactions
  • Headache
  • Dizziness

Serious Side Effects

Though rare, serious adverse reactions can occur, such as:

  • Severe allergic reactions (anaphylaxis)
  • Clostridium difficile-associated diarrhea
  • Hepatotoxicity (liver damage)
  • Blood disorders (e.g., hemolytic anemia)

Precautions and Warnings

  • Allergy history: Patients allergic to penicillin or other cephalosporins should inform their healthcare provider before taking cephalexin.
  • Pregnancy and breastfeeding: Consult your doctor to determine if this medication is appropriate during pregnancy or lactation.
  • Interactions: Be aware of potential drug interactions, especially with medications like warfarin or other blood thinners.

Usage Guidelines and Important Considerations

Proper Administration

To maximize effectiveness and reduce resistance risk:

  • Take cephalexin exactly as prescribed by your healthcare provider.
  • Complete the entire course of therapy, even if symptoms improve before finishing the medication.
  • Take the medication with a full glass of water, preferably with food to minimize stomach upset.

Storage Recommendations

Store generic Keflex at room temperature, away from moisture, heat, and sunlight. Keep out of reach of children.

Missed Dose and Overdose

  • If you miss a dose, take it as soon as possible. If it’s nearly time for the next dose, skip the missed one—do not double up.
  • In case of overdose, seek immediate medical attention. Symptoms may include severe gastrointestinal distress or allergic reactions.
